#798499 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#798499 is composed of 47.5% red, 51.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 219.4 degrees, a saturation of 13.6% and a lightness of 53.7%. #798499 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ffff with #000933.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#798499

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08090b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#798499

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828790 is the less saturated color, while #1565fd is the most saturated one.
